How Many Sugar is in Bourbon?
Bourbon does not contain any sugar as it is made from a fermented grain mash and then aged in charred oak barrels. However, some bourbons may be blended with other ingredients that contain sugar, such as flavored syrups or liqueurs, which can increase their sugar content. Additionally, mixers used in bourbon cocktails may also contain added sugars.
How Many Carbs in Bourbon?
Bourbon is a distilled spirit made from grains, which means that it contains very few carbs. Generally, a 1.5-ounce serving of bourbon contains 0 grams of carbs. The only exception is flavored bourbons that are blended with other ingredients such as syrups or liqueurs, which can contain some carbohydrates. However, even in such cases, the carb content is usually very low.
Calories in Bourbon
There are roughly 97 calories in a 1.5oz shot of 80-proof whiskey according to the USDA. The number of calories in bourbon can vary depending on the brand and the proof. On average, a 1.5-ounce serving of bourbon contains approximately 97-124 calories. However, higher proof bourbons can contain more calories due to their increased alcohol content. Additionally, flavored bourbons that are blended with other ingredients may contain additional calories from added sugars. It is important to drink bourbon in moderation and factor in its calorie content as a part of a balanced diet.
Calories in a Glass of Bourbon
The number of calories in a glass of bourbon can vary depending on the size of the glass and the amount of bourbon it contains. If you are drinking a standard 2-ounce pour, that would be approximately 130-166 calories. However, if you are drinking a larger pour, such as a 3-ounce serving, the calorie count would be higher. It’s important to drink bourbon in moderation and consider its calorie content as part of a healthy diet.
Calories in a Shot of Bourbon
A standard shot of bourbon is typically 1.5 ounces and contains approximately 97-124 calories, depending on the brand and proof. However, the calorie count may be higher if a larger shot is poured. It’s important to drink bourbon in moderation and factor in its calorie content as a part of a balanced diet.
Calories in Vodka
The number of calories in vodka varies depending on the brand and the proof (alcohol content). On average, a 1.5-ounce serving of 80-proof vodka (40% alcohol) contains about 97 calories. However, flavored vodkas often contain more calories due to added sugars and other ingredients. It is important to consume alcohol in moderation and factor in the calorie content when making dietary choices.
